当前位置:首页 > CN2资讯 > 正文内容

Linux查看ZIP文件内容的最佳命令和技巧

2个月前 (03-20)CN2资讯

什么是ZIP文件?

谈到ZIP文件,简单来说,它是一种压缩文件格式,常用于将多个文件打包在一起,以减少存储空间并便于传输。ZIP文件的设计使得在解压时,能够以原始格式还原存档内的文件。这种特性特别适合需要压缩大量数据的场景,如发送邮件、上传文件或备份数据。

ZIP文件的最大特点在于它的兼容性。几乎所有操作系统都支持ZIP格式,这包括Windows、macOS和Linux等。它能有效地保存不同类型的文件,无论是文档、图片还是程序代码。因而,无论你是在处理个人文件还是在进行软件开发,ZIP文件都提供了一种便捷的方式来管理和分享这些数据。

在使用ZIP文件的过程中,大家可能会碰到如何查看ZIP文件内部的内容。这可以通过各种工具和命令来实现。接下来,我将介绍一下在Linux环境下,如何高效地查看ZIP文件的内容,帮助大家更好地处理文件。我们将深入探讨相关的Linux命令,如unzipzipinfo,让你在处理ZIP文件时游刃有余。

如何查看ZIP文件的内容?

在Linux系统中,查看ZIP文件的内容并不复杂。首先,我会介绍一些适合用于这一目的的命令,让你可以轻松获取ZIP文件内的内容列表并查看每个文件的详细信息。

使用Linux命令查看ZIP内容

在Linux环境下,最常用的命令之一就是unzip。这个命令不仅可以用来解压ZIP文件,还能让你查看ZIP文件的内容。通过简单的命令,你可以快速了解ZIP包中都有哪些文件以及它们的基本信息。此外,zipinfo是另一个有用的工具,专门用于显示ZIP文件的详细信息,比如文件大小、压缩比等。通过这两种命令,你可以全面掌握ZIP文件的结构和内容。

适当工具和命令推荐

我推荐从最基本的unzip -l命令开始。这个命令会列出ZIP文件中所有文件的名称,以及它们的大小和日期信息。如果你需要更详细的信息,比如每个文件的压缩率,zipinfo将是更好的选择。运行zipinfo [zip文件名]后,你会看到每个文件的详细信息,能够帮助你做出判断,哪些文件是必要的,哪些可以考虑删除或压缩。

通过这些简单的命令,查看ZIP文件的内容变得非常方便。无论你是在处理压缩的备份文件,还是接收朋友发送的资料,这些工具都能帮助你高效地管理和使用ZIP文件。接下来,我们将进一步解析这些命令的具体用法,助力你的文件管理变得更加顺畅。

常见查看ZIP文件内容的命令解析

我发现对于想要快速查看ZIP文件内容的用户来说,了解一些基本的命令非常有帮助。特别是在Linux环境下,以下两个命令unzipzipinfo无疑是最常用和有用的工具。我会详细解析这两个命令的用法,帮助你高效管理ZIP文件。

unzip命令的用法详解

unzip命令不仅可以解压缩文件,还能列出ZIP文件内的文件清单。如果我想查看某个ZIP文件的所有文件,我会使用unzip -l [zip文件名],这样可以直接得到一个简洁的文件列表。在这个列表中,每个文件的名称、大小、以及最后修改日期都会一目了然。这对于我而言,非常高效,能够迅速了解ZIP文件的内容。

除了简单的文件列表,有时我需要了解每个文件的详细信息。unzip -v [zip文件名]这个命令就能满足我的需求。它显示的内容包括每个文件的压缩比例、压缩前后的大小等信息,这为我后续的文件管理提供了很好的依据。如果我想更详细地分析哪个文件可能会占用过多空间,这个命令显得尤为重要。

zipinfo命令的使用

接下来重点介绍zipinfo命令。这是一个专门用于查看ZIP文件详细信息的工具,非常适合在我需要深入了解文件内容时使用。运行命令zipinfo [zip文件名]后,屏幕上会显示每个文件的大小、压缩比以及文件权限等信息。一目了然,为我分辨文件提供了便利。

通过zipinfo命令,我可以非常轻松地获得关于ZIP文件的整体信息,并且能迅速进而做出相应的决策,比如是保留还是删除某些文件。每当我处理重要的压缩文件时,确保对其内容有清晰的认识常常能帮助我避免不必要的麻烦。

在掌握了这些命令的具体用法后,获取ZIP文件的信息将变得毫无压力。通过命令的灵活运用,自然能够使我在文件管理中游刃有余。接下来的部分中,我将探讨一些实用的技巧以及处理ZIP文件时的常见问题,帮助大家更进一步地提升工作效率。

实践与实用技巧

在实际操作中,我们总会遇到一些问题或者需要提高工作效率的场景。在处理ZIP文件时,我总结出了一些实用的小技巧和常见问题的解决方法,以便大家在使用Linux命令查看ZIP文件内容时更加顺畅。

错误处理与常见问题

在使用unzip或者zipinfo命令时,我常会遇到一些常见的错误。比如,有时候密码保护的ZIP文件无法直接查看内容。遇到这样的情况,我发现通过指令unzip -l [zip文件名]可能会显示一个错误提示,告知文件需要密码才能解锁。这时,我需要先获取密码再进行操作,这样就能顺利查看文件内容了。

另一个常见的问题是ZIP文件损坏。我们偶尔会下载到损坏的文件,使用命令unzip时可能弹出“文件损坏”或“无法解压”的警告。这时,我会尝试使用zip -T [zip文件名]来测试文件的完整性。如果显示出错误,我通常会重新下载文件,确保手中有一个完好的ZIP文件。

提高效率的小技巧

为了提高查看ZIP文件内容的效率,我尝试了一些小技巧。例如,结合使用find命令和unzip,我可以快速找到特定文件。在命令行中通过find . -name "*.zip" -exec unzip -l {} \;能够一次性列出当前目录及子目录下所有ZIP文件的内容,节省了逐个查看的时间。

还有一个小窍门是使用moreless命令来浏览输出的内容。由于ZIP文件有时包含大量文件信息,直接在终端中查看可能会让人眼花缭乱。将命令引入到less中,比如unzip -l [zip文件名] | less,就可以方便地逐行查看,随时滚动上下。这种方法让我更轻松地查找需要的信息,而不会错过重要细节。

其他压缩格式的内容查看总结

除了ZIP文件,我也经常需要处理其他类型的压缩文件。比如,tar文件和gzip文件也很常见。对于这些文件,我发现可以使用tar -tf [文件名.tar]来查看tar文件的内容,而zcat [文件名.gz]可以查看gzip文件的内容。这些命令充分展示了Linux的强大功能,让我能够轻松管理多种压缩格式。

综合来看,灵活运用这些技巧和命令,能够帮助我在管理ZIP文件时更有效率。这些经验,既可以避免常见的问题,又使我在面对复杂情况时从容应对。希望这些实用的技巧能为你带来便利,让你在使用Linux管理文件时游刃有余。

    扫描二维码推送至手机访问。

    版权声明:本文由皇冠云发布,如需转载请注明出处。

    本文链接:https://www.idchg.com/info/6830.html

    分享给朋友:

    “Linux查看ZIP文件内容的最佳命令和技巧” 的相关文章

    ZGOVPS高性能VPS主机:提升网站速度与跨境访问体验的最佳选择

    ZGOVPS的背景与市场定位 ZGOVPS是一家专注于提供高性能VPS主机服务的商家,凭借其出色的性价比和良好的用户口碑,迅速在站长圈中站稳了脚跟。它的市场定位非常明确,主要服务于那些对网络性能有较高要求的用户,尤其是需要跨境访问的网站。对于国内用户来说,访问国外机房时常常会遇到线路问题,导致访问速...

    搭建VPN梯子的最佳VPS推荐,轻松畅游网络

    在探索Internet的过程中,VPN梯子的搭建显得尤为重要。VPN梯子,简单来说,是通过虚拟专用网络(VPN)创建的一个安全通道,它能够帮助用户绕过地理限制,访问被封锁的网站和服务。随着互联网信息安全和隐私保护需求的增加,搭建VPN梯子成为越来越多用户的选择。 想象一下,当我们在国外旅行时,无法访...

    ICMP vs TCP:网络测试中的最佳协议选择

    当我们谈论网络协议时,ICMP(Internet Control Message Protocol)和TCP(Transmission Control Protocol)是两个重要的角色。它们虽然都在网络通信中扮演着关键的角色,却有着截然不同的功能和应用。理解这两种协议的定义及其特性,能够帮助我在构...

    Virmach虚拟主机评测:高性价比VPS服务推荐

    大家好,今天我想和你聊一聊Virmach,这是一家我非常推荐的虚拟主机提供商。Virmach专注于提供VPS(虚拟专用服务器)服务,近年来逐渐在行业中赢得了一席之地。它的价格相对亲民,而服务质量与稳定性也让人感到满意。很多人选择它,主要是因为它不仅适合个人用户,也非常受中小企业欢迎。 Virmach...

    探索诸暨市:地理特征、气候与经济发展全面分析

    我发现诸暨市,这个位于浙江省中北部的县级市,真是一个令人着迷的地方。它东靠嵊州市,南面与东阳、义乌和浦江相邻,西面与桐庐和富阳相接,北边则与柯桥和萧山为界。这样的地理位置赋予了诸暨市独特的区域特色,方便了与周边城市的交流与发展。 在谈到诸暨的地理特征时,不得不提其独特的地形地貌。诸暨市位于浙东南和浙...

    解决Linode被封的问题与账户恢复策略分享

    Linode作为一款备受欢迎的美国VPS,其灵活性和服务质量吸引了众多用户。然而,基于我的经验,国内用户在使用Linode时常常面临被封的困扰。这不仅影响了使用体验,也对业务的持续性造成了影响。我想深入分析一下Linode被封的原因。 首先,Linode的全球网络状况在近年来遭遇了严峻挑战。随着越来...